Comparing Buying a Single-Family Home vs. a Duplex
When buying property in Florida, the processes for buying a single-family house and a duplex are largely related, particularly in credit score necessities and down funds.
For each sorts of properties, whether or not single-family houses or duplexes, consumers sometimes want a minimal credit score rating of 620 for typical and 500 for FHA loans.
It’s vital to notice that whereas the VA would not specify a minimal credit score rating, most lenders are likely to require one. The minimal down cost additionally aligns carefully, starting from 3% to fifteen% for typical loans, 3.5% for FHA loans, and probably 0% for VA loans, relevant to each property varieties.
The important divergence seems in the insurance coverage area: a single-family house typically requires a customary householders insurance coverage coverage, whereas proudly owning a duplex in Florida necessitates each a householders coverage and a rental property coverage, reflecting the twin nature of residing in one unit and renting out the opposite.

Did you verify Florida duplex mortgage limits?
If you are contemplating shopping for a duplex, your lender’s mortgage limits are value wanting into. A mortgage restrict is the utmost amount of cash you may borrow with a mortgage or house fairness mortgage, and the Federal Housing Finance Agency (FHFA) units them.
These limits are primarily based on the county in which you reside and its corresponding median house value. Because these limits apply to each main residences and second houses, many first-time homebuyers use them as a instrument for affordability.
In Miami-Dade County, Florida, the 2024 FHA mortgage restrict for a single-family house is $621,000. But when you’re searching for a duplex, you may safe a mortgage of as much as $795,000 – that is 28% extra borrowing energy in comparison with a single-family house in the identical space!
Remember, these are simply examples – the distinction in mortgage limits for single-family and multi-unit properties can differ considerably relying on the precise county you are in inside Florida.

Rental revenue may also help you qualify for bigger mortgage limits
Many suppose shopping for a duplex as an alternative of a single-family house is simply too dangerous. But it may be far much less dangerous than you suppose!
One of the most important benefits of shopping for a duplex as your first house is utilizing future rental revenue from one or each models to qualify for bigger mortgage limits. This means you can purchase extra homes for much less cash, making it a superb funding alternative.
According to Fannie Mae, 75 % of the potential rental revenue can offset mortgage debt-to-income ratios.
There are guidelines round how a lot you may hire out a house earlier than you begin wanting like an investor moderately than an owner-occupant, however these guidelines should not too onerous. It would assist when you confirmed that you simply intend to stay in the unit as your main residence for a minimum of 12 months.

Preparing for Landlord Duties with a Florida Duplex
Renting out half of a duplex in Florida entails distinctive preparations past the same old first-time homebuying course of.
In Florida, it is important to familiarize your self with the state-specific landlord-tenant legal guidelines to know your authorized obligations and any potential hire management measures. Additionally, a thorough market evaluation is essential to find out aggressive rental costs in your space.
As a future landlord in Florida, you may want to arrange varied paperwork for potential tenants. These ought to embody varieties for credit score checks, background checks, revenue verification, rental historical past, and private references.
Another important step is creating a detailed inspection type. This type is used to document the situation of the rental unit each at first and finish of a tenancy.
Conduct a complete walk-through along with your tenant throughout move-in and move-out to finish this kind.
For added safety and readability, taking time-stamped images of the unit’s situation at these occasions is advisable. These data are invaluable for monitoring any modifications or damages throughout the rental interval.
